Output 24fa41d854c75f770116c56d66e1d5f25a6be16045d19b217570b6731423f523:1

value
4103696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f75188ce1d14b58064645608ce2ddf99a28d73c0 OP_EQUAL
address
3QEiW2yq3Zyc43ELyvf4oKefjpU2FmShVZ
transaction
24fa41d854c75f770116c56d66e1d5f25a6be16045d19b217570b6731423f523
spent
true